### Step 4: Pin Your Dependencies

Quick heads-up: on the Bramblewick stack we pin everything — no floating versions, no ranges. Run `pindler lock` after any dependency change and commit the lockfile, or CI will bounce you. This matters for the migration because the new resolver verifies pins against the registry mirror at install time. The verifier stores its audit results in the shared migration database, reachable via the connection string below.

replica DSN, kajep-yahag: mssql://praok_svc:iF@db-8d68.plorvaio.local:5432/eliion

Hi all,

Bulk edits in the Selwyn admin table are ready for review. The change batches row updates into a single transaction, adds a confirm step for edits touching more than fifty rows, and logs each batch to the audit trail. Nothing else in the grid changed. The candidate build for review is tagged with the token below.

trace token, kaduf-kadup: htk14_d0223cc3c18e70

Eng sync notes — EXIF scrubbing

Quick update: the Pictonomy uploader now strips GPS and device EXIF tags on ingest, not at publish time. Old assets get backfilled over the next two weeks via the Scrubcart batch job. Watch the error channel for oversized TIFFs. Any scrubbing edge cases this week should go straight to the person now owning this.

named custodian: Belius Casath Ulaix Sorius